The H-E-B Center in Cedar Park is a state-of-the-art, 8,700-seat entertainment and sports facility. Opened in 2009, it hosts over 150 events annually and is home to the Texas Stars (NHL affiliate) and Austin Spurs (NBA affiliate), making it a vibrant hub for local and regional attractions.
The Crossover in Cedar Park is a dynamic, family-oriented athletic training, wellness, and entertainment center offering over 200,000 square feet of space. Featuring indoor and outdoor turf fields, two full-size ice rinks, a restaurant, event space, worship services, and more, The Crossover provides a versatile environment for things to do in Cedar Park.
Haute Spot offers 2,500 square feet of indoor dining space and 25,000 square feet of outdoor event space, making it an ideal venue for business activation, small group meetings, or private parties. With in-house restaurant, lawn games, and live entertainment, Haute Spot offers a vibrant, flexible setting for any occasion.
Nebraska Furniture Mart (NFM) is one of the largest home furnishings stores in North America, selling furniture, appliances, and electronics. Its newest location, opening in 2025 near Cedar Park’s H-E-B Center and Hotel Convention Center, will span 560,000 square feet, making it the company’s largest store.
Scheels is bringing its renowned All Sports store to Cedar Park in 2026, offering 240,000 square feet of premium retail space at The Colony near NFM and the H-E-B Center. The store will feature entertainment attractions, specialty shops, and boutiques showcasing top brands and premium products.
Cedar Park’s upcoming Hotel Convention Center, anchored by NFM, will feature a 250-room hotel and a city-owned, 30,000 square-foot convention center. The new facility will empower local businesses and the Cedar Park Chamber to host their own events, conferences, and gatherings.
Brushy Creek Sports Park is a versatile recreational facility featuring two baseball/softball fields, a basketball court, a 9-hole disc golf course, a playscape, and a popular skate park. The park also offers scenic trails, making it a great destination for outdoor activities and family fun.
Brushy Creek Regional Trail in Cedar Park is a paved 10-mile walking, jogging, and biking trail that offers natural scenery and peaceful views. Connecting several parks, retail centers, businesses, and residential communities, the trail provides a scenic and convenient route for outdoor recreation and daily commuting.
